About Fond du Lac
If you're seeking a slice of Americana with a healthy dose of affordability, Fond du Lac, Wisconsin, should be on your radar. This city of nearly 45,000 residents offers a refreshing alternative to the soaring costs of living in major metropolitan areas. Here, the median home value clocks in at a remarkably accessible $148,500, a stark contrast to the national average. You'll find a welcoming community, a slower pace of life, and a strong sense of Midwestern charm. Fond du Lac is a place where you can stretch your dollar further, allowing you to enjoy life's simple pleasures without the constant pressure of financial strain. From an investment perspective, Fond du Lac presents a compelling case. While the median household income of around $58,675 reflects the regional economic landscape, the lower housing costs mean a higher quality of life is readily attainable. The city offers a stable job market, and a generally safe environment, making it an ideal choice for families, first-time homebuyers, and those seeking a more relaxed lifestyle. This is a place where you can put down roots, build equity, and enjoy the peace of mind that comes with a solid investment in a thriving, friendly community.
